MASV recently announced that customers can now send directly from their cloud storage using MASV's ultra-fast cloud-based transfer platform, revolutionizing media delivery for sports and video professionals. MASV Send from Amazon S3' and Send from Wasabi' eliminates the need to download from cloud storage onto a local machine, to later re-upload to transfer. Combined with MASV's unique Multiconnect bonded internet and 10Gbps optimization, sports video professionals can transfer footage into the cloud faster than ever.
MASV recently helped RugbyPass with improve its existing slow and inefficient video ingestion, which was leading to workflow delays. RugbyPass used a MASV Portal to request files from multiple contributors around resulting in ultra-fast automatic ingest to S3 cloud storage via MASV. Simultaneous uploads turned hours of work into 15 minutes.
In the fast-paced sports broadcasting industry, where speed is crucial, MASV's fast and reliable transfers have revolutionized RugbyPass' workflow, eliminating the anxiety of large video ingest.
MASV allow recently worked with a major sports streaming service, which was sending terabytes of 4K footage post-event over unstable internet from stadiums and arenas worldwide. The process was often cumbersome and caused significant headaches for the team. The MASV desktop app simplified uploading to S3 storage with reliable max speed for large files (up to 15TB each). The headless MASV Transfer Agent also allowed automated workflows with outstanding reliability. And MASV cloud integration accelerated transfers to and from S3 at max speed and reliability, even to recipients outside the organization.
With MASV, the streaming service is now able to enjoy lightning-fast transfer speeds worldwide. They can seamlessly upload unlimited files of up to 15TB each into their S3 bucket, leading to significant savings in both time and costs during post-production.
